CWA 2011 Annual Conference 'CONNECTED' Set for Oct. 24-25 in San Antonio

  Share This Story

The Construction Writers Association (CWA), an international organization for journalism, photography, marketing and communications professionals in the construction industry, will hold its 2011 annual conference, "CONNECTED," Oct. 24-25 at the Westin Riverwalk in San Antonio, Texas.

The conference will kick off with a Habitat for Humanity volunteer work project. "CWA is proud to give back to the construction industry by offering its members a memorable experience on a home-building jobsite," said program co-chair Kim Phelan.

The project also will give construction writers an opportunity to interview executives from Habitat, which is celebrating its 35th anniversary.

The conference will feature presentations on key issues affecting the construction industry; educational workshops; a panel discussion on Web communications, including writing for the Web, blogging, copyright issues, search engine optimization and social media; and a construction site tour of the Brooke Army Medical Center at Fort Sam Houston, which will be nearing completion this fall.

Speakers will include:

  • Doug McMurry, executive vice president, San Antonio Associated General Contractors of America, and Michelle McMurry, a former managing editor, San Antonio Construction News, and current editor-in-chief, San Antonio TASTE.
  • Robert Rivard, editor, San Antonio Express-News.
  • Eugenio Alemàn, senior economist, Wells Fargo.
  • Nick Mavrick, vice president of marketing, Volvo Rents.
  • Jane Baxter Lynn, executive director, U.S. Green Building Council Central Texas.
  • Pattie Porter, principal, "The Texas Conflict Coach."
  • Sandy Hamby, vice president, MOCA Systems, Brooke Army Medical Center project at Fort Sam Houston.

The conference will also include a Grand Awards Dinner on Oct. 25 honoring this year's Silver Hard Hat, Hall of Fame, Journalism, Photography, Marketing Communications, and Website and Electronic Communications award winners.

Sponsors are: Platinum, Caterpillar, Inc. and Marketwire; Gold, Award Company of America, John Deere, McCarthy Building Companies, National Asphalt Pavement Association and Randall-Reilly; Silver, Hilti and Performance Marketing; Bronze, Portland Cement Association and The Texas Conflict Coach; and Collaborative: ASA Chicago.

The Construction Writers Association (CWA), founded in 1958, is a non-profit, non-partisan, international organization that provides a forum for journalism, photography, marketing, and communications professionals in all segments of the construction industry to connect with other professionals and enhance skills through education.
